Senior Legal Counsel, Cloud

Beijing, China March 12, 2026 Full Time Tencent Careers Portal (Proprietary)
What the Role Entails This role provides legal support across cloud computing, technology licensing, and product compliance for Tencent’s global businesses. You will draft, review, and negotiate complex commercial and software licensing agreements, while advising on regulatory and compliance matters across multiple jurisdictions. Working closely with internal teams and international external counsel, you will identify legal risks, design practical solutions, and maintain alignment with global regulatory standards. The role also involves improving internal policies, strengthening knowledge management, and delivering training on compliance topics. The ideal candidate brings at least three years of experience in technology-focused legal work, strong academic credentials, and solid exposure to IP, open-source, and technology licensing. You should be detail-oriented, commercially minded, able to manage end-to-end transactions independently, and comfortable working in a fast-paced environment. Strong communication skills, bilingual proficiency in Mandarin and English, and enthusiasm for cloud and emerging technologies are essential.1.Advise on a wide range of legal and commercial matters in the areas of cloud computing, technology licensing and product compliance. 2.Draft, review, and negotiate complex software license agreements, professional services agreements, and other general commercial agreements. 3.Collaborate with external counsel and other Tencent attorneys based around the world, including in mainland China, Singapore, EU, and the US, to provide compliance and regulatory analysis and advice for international business initiatives. 4.Identify potential legal issues and pitfalls and devise creative solutions for business teams to efficiently mitigate compliance risks. 5.Develop and continuously identify areas of improvement in our internal policies, case and knowledge management, trainings, and processes to ensure operational efficiency and implement practices for
